CSAT vs. NPS is an inevitable comparison that surfaces whenever a company launches a Voice of the Customer (VoC) program to optimize their customer experience (CX) strategy. . While there are many different metrics within a VoC program, two very prominent ones are Customer Satisfaction Score (CSAT) and Net Promoter Score (NPS).

One of the most popular measures of customer experience is the Net Promoter Score (NPS), which is a measure of loyalty to your brand and an effective method to determine customer likelihood to repurchase, refer friends and family, and resist market pressure to deflect to a competitor.

According to Marketing Metrics , you have a much higher probability to sell your existing customers than a new prospect, at 60 to 70% versus 5 to 20%, respectively. Customer Experience Management (CEM) is a methodology of measuring business performance based on the voice of the customer at all touch points in order to drive continuous customer-focused improvements.
